The refractive index of glass w.t.r. a medium is `4/3` . If `v_m - v_g = 6.25 xx 10^(7)`m/s. then the velocity oflight in the medim will be

A

`2.5 xx 10^(8)` m/s

B

`2.25 xx 10^(8)` m/s

C

`1.875 xx 10^(8)` m/ s

D

`1.5 xx 10^(8)` m/s

Text Solution

Verified by Experts

The correct Answer is:
A

`""_(m) n_(g) = (V_(m))/(V_(g)) = (4)/(3) therefore V_(m) = (4)/(3) V_(g)`
`therefore V_(m) - V_(g) = V_(g) ((4)/(3) - 1) = (V_(g))/(3)`
`therefore (V_(g))/(3) = 6.25 xx 10^(7) therefore V_(g) = 1.875 xx 10^(8) `m/s
`V_(m) = (4)/(3) V_(g) = 2.5 xx 10^(8)` m/s
